Artist: Louis Willaume
Louis WILLAUME 1874-1949
French landscape and city painter, engraver and illustrator.
A pupil of the great William Bouguereau and Gabriel Ferrier, the painter's career was crowned with success.

He won several medals at the Salon des artistes français (silver and gold), the Prix Corot in 1923 and the gold medal for the engraving section in 1929.
His paintings were exhibited throughout France, as well as in Spain, Switzerland and Japan.
His real passion? Paris!

He painted on the spot or from sketches he drew while out and about.
He is fond of gray tones, and his canvases are often painted in this chromatic range.
But his paintings are no less vivid and luminous.
